Address

1PFA58Z6wr42MMVPdxEjKJjvsyqUJ4nAAb

0 RXD

Confirmed
Total Received41171.42226529 RXD270.94 HKD
Total Sent41171.42226529 RXD270.94 HKD
Final Balance0 RXD0.00 HKD
No. Transactions2

Transactions

1PFA58Z6wr42MMVPdxEjKJjvsyqUJ4nAAb41171.42226529 RXD270.94 HKD270.94 HKD
 
1NyPy8qqYGRVtQPSuLxRVYjp8rnYqp9zQc3164.14325177 RXD20.82 HKD20.82 HKD
1BYgMQ7fEcNJRw4qyuk1DyRCTjEyh6iUFT38007.27676352 RXD250.12 HKD250.12 HKD
1NrFQU3vM7sv8cBXXAuRAQ9J1Ltgr87vGd42729.56492629 RXD281.19 HKD281.19 HKD
 
13x6zhWXtSKXquYnGUrbBKdi6hKGpAP1Sj1558.14041100 RXD10.25 HKD10.25 HKD
1PFA58Z6wr42MMVPdxEjKJjvsyqUJ4nAAb41171.42226529 RXD270.94 HKD270.94 HKD